Yup, Foundry do 7 sculpts, sure they are still for sale. Malifaux do some undead gunslinger types and toher undead western folk.

Newline design do a vampire coven in wild west gear.

You could use mantic heads and zombiefy some plastics, work quite well if using ACW figures. I think there are old posts of some of mine.

Reaper do 2 in their Deadlands range and you may be able to pick some up form the old game. Dinally I think knuckleduster or some one does some too

Check the deadlands figure thread you may find some bits there too
